Championship Golf Through Percy Warner Park

Harpeth Hills Golf Course, nestled within the scenic Percy Warner Park, stands as Nashville's premier municipal golf facility. Originally designed in 1965 and expertly redesigned in 1991 by Allen Brown & Herschel Eaton, this championship layout offers 6,899 yards of challenging golf through rolling Tennessee hills.

The course features dramatic elevation changes with minimal water hazards, emphasizing strategic shot placement and course management over forced carries. The natural wildlife habitat surrounding each hole creates a serene, park-like setting that showcases some of Nashville's most beautiful scenery.

In 2017, Harpeth Hills elevated its championship credentials with the installation of new TifEagle ultra-dwarf Bermuda greens, providing putting surfaces that rival any private club. As a former USGA Public Links Championship qualifying site, the course maintains tournament-quality conditions while remaining accessible to the public at exceptional municipal rates.

Signature Holes

Discover the holes that define the Harpeth Hills experience

9

The Amphitheater

Yards
445
Par
4
Handicap
1

A spectacular finishing hole for the front nine with an elevated tee shot to a fairway that slopes toward the clubhouse. The approach shot plays to a well-guarded green with the clubhouse and Percy Warner Park serving as a dramatic backdrop.

18

Home Sweet Home

Yards
415
Par
4
Handicap
5

The signature finishing hole features a dramatic uphill approach to an elevated green with the historic clubhouse as a backdrop. This challenging par-4 demands both distance and accuracy, providing a memorable conclusion to your round.
